|
Common Stock Warrant Liability (Details) (USD $)
|0 Months Ended
|12 Months Ended
|
Feb. 23, 2010
|
Feb. 22, 2011
|
Dec. 31, 2014
|
Dec. 31, 2013
|
May 31, 2013
|
Mar. 31, 2012
|Estimated fair value of warrants accounted for as derivative liabilities [Abstract]
|Number of Warrant Shares Issuable (in shares)
|15,500,000
|Fair Value of Warrants
|$ 1,258,000
|$ 5,425,000
|Exercise price of warrants (in dollars per share)
|$ 2.81
|Five Year Warrant 2 [Member]
|Estimated fair value of warrants accounted for as derivative liabilities [Abstract]
|Issuance Date
|Feb. 23, 2010
|Number of Warrant Shares Issuable (in shares)
|916,669
|Exercise Price (in dollars per share)
|$ 12.75
|Warrant Expiration Date
|Feb. 23, 2015
|Fair Value of Warrants
|5,701,000
|0
|6,000
|February 2011 warrants [Member]
|Class of Warrant or Right [Line Items]
|Exercisable period of warrants
|5 years
|Estimated fair value of warrants accounted for as derivative liabilities [Abstract]
|Issuance Date
|Feb. 22, 2011
|Number of Warrant Shares Issuable (in shares)
|4,550,100
|Exercise Price (in dollars per share)
|$ 1.50
|Warrant Expiration Date
|Feb. 22, 2016
|Fair Value of Warrants
|8,004,000
|1,258,000
|5,419,000
|Exercise of warrants by warrant holders to purchase common stock (in shares)
|284,850
|113,800
|Proceeds from exercise of warrants
|$ 400,000
|$ 200,000
|Exercise price of warrants (in dollars per share)
|$ 3.20
|$ 1.50
|$ 1.50
|$ 2.80
|X
|
- Definition
Date the warrants or rights expire, in CCYY-MM-DD format.
No definition available.
|X
|
- Definition
Date the warrants or rights were issued, in CCYY-MM-DD format.
No definition available.
|X
|
- Definition
The exercise price of each class of warrants or rights outstanding.
No definition available.
|X
|
- Details
|X
|
- Definition
Represents period within which warrants are exercisable.
No definition available.
|X
|
- Definition
Represents number of shares issued upon exercise of warrants during the period.
No definition available.
|X
|
- Definition
Exercise price per share or per unit of warrants or rights outstanding.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Details
|X
|
- Definition
Number of warrants or rights outstanding.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
Fair value, after the effects of master netting arrangements, of a financial liability or contract with one or more underlyings, notional amount or payment provision or both, and the contract can be net settled by means outside the contract or delivery of an asset. Includes liabilities not subject to a master netting arrangement and not elected to be offset.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
The cash inflow associated with the amount received from holders exercising their stock warrants.
No definition available.
|X
|
- Details
|X
|
- Details